5 Easy Facts About different sources of APIs Described

As outlined by Woodcock, Innovative producing is a collective expression for new health care-product producing technologies which will enhance drug excellent, address shortages of medicines, and pace time-to-market. She explained that Innovative producing technology, which the FDA supports via its Rising Technological innovation Plan has a smaller sized facility footprint, decrease environmental impact, and a lot more effective utilization of human resources than conventional engineering, and features systems for instance ongoing producing and three-D printing.

On top of that, it really should highlight any particular authentication necessities or accessibility limitations affiliated with Every endpoint.

API production is a posh system, and companies needs to have a deep knowledge of chemistry and engineering to be successful. Hence, by far the most effective API companies are those that have invested closely in exploration and advancement.

Numerous Lively pharma substances manufacturing companies offer poor-excellent APIs that, if utilised, may result in inefficient medicines and fatalities. That’s why it is vital to outsource your API manufacturing into a reputed corporation obtaining the demanded resources and expertise. 

API screening will involve numerous tactics making sure that the API features as predicted. This incorporates device tests, in which specific API endpoints are analyzed in isolation, and integration tests, exactly where various endpoints and their interactions are analyzed together.

Comprehending the different protocols and knowledge formats Utilized in APIs is essential mainly because it influences how builders website interact with APIs and method the returned data.

RBAC supplies a versatile and scalable method of handling obtain control, especially in complex apps with multiple person roles and various levels of authorization.

RAML is an additional specification for planning and documenting RESTful APIs. It offers a concise and expressive language for describing APIs, which include resource buildings, request and response schemas, and security techniques. RAML emphasizes reusability and modularity, rendering it read more easier to build and maintain scalable APIs.

GraphQL APIs use a schema to outline the available knowledge and operations. Customers can mail queries towards the server, plus the response consists of only the asked for information, cutting down community overhead and strengthening effectiveness.

1 critical facet of gRPC is its support for numerous programming languages, enabling developers to seamlessly build APIs and customer-server conversation regardless of the programming languages they use. This overall flexibility makes gRPC ideal for making dispersed techniques and microservices architectures.

“Quotient Sciences is definitely an trustworthy and straight-forward corporation with a really progressive Angle... What helps make them exceptional is how by which the pharmaceutical items are created on internet site and transferred, without the need of leaving the building, to your scientific device and a fantastic, huge and reliable pool of healthy volunteers.”

This reaction ordinarily has the asked for info or informs the consumer the asked for action has actually been finished. APIs use several different strategies to transfer information concerning the shopper and server, together with HTTP, HTTPS, and TCP/IP.

A protocol presents defined principles for API calls. It specifies the acknowledged data types and instructions. Allow’s evaluate the numerous protocol types for APIs:

Consumers can obtain these endpoints by creating HTTP requests on the corresponding URLs. The URLs generally incorporate supplemental parameters or query strings to specify the desired facts or Procedure.

Leave a Reply

Your email address will not be published. Required fields are marked *